Vincent Greff's repositories
aeron
Efficient reliable UDP unicast, UDP multicast, and IPC message transport
aeron-cookbook-code
Source code related to Aeron cookbook
awesome-cpp
A curated list of awesome C++ (or C) frameworks, libraries, resources, and shiny things. Inspired by awesome-... stuff.
awesome-modern-cpp
A collection of resources on modern C++
CMake-Best-Practices
CMake Best Practices, by Packt Publishing
cmake-google-tests
Skeleton CMake project that integrates Google Tests
conan-boost
Example c++ project using boost and conan
cpp-ipc
C++ IPC Library: A high-performance inter-process communication using shared memory on Linux/Windows.
Effective-Modern-Cpp
Sample code for the Effective Modern C++ book by Scott Meyers.
examples
Several Conan examples as resources for documentation and blog posts
CPlusPlus20ForProgrammers
Code examples for our book _C++ 20 for Programmers_ (Pearson, 2020)
CPP-20-STL-Cookbook
C++ 20 STL Cookbook, published by Packt
fmtlog
fmtlog is a performant fmtlib-style logging library with latency in nanoseconds.
GalacticGuardian
A video game design project set in space where you fight enemies as a spaceship.
hexdump
A header-only utility for writing hexdump-formatted data to C++ streams.
modern-cpp-features
A cheatsheet of modern C++ language and library features.
NanoLog
Nanolog is an extremely performant nanosecond scale logging system for C++ that exposes a simple printf-like API.
SPMC_Queue
A simple and efficient single producer multiple consumer queue, suititable for both ITC and IPC.
SPSC_Queue
A highly optimized single producer single consumer message queue C++ template
Synology_enable_M2_volume
Enable creating volumes with non-Synology M.2 drives
Template-Metaprogramming-with-CPP
Template Metaprogramming with C++, published by Packt
tscns
A low overhead nanosecond clock based on x86 TSC
vscode-makefile-tools
MAKE integration in Visual Studio Code